Popular Wordlists
  • word of the day


    denizen - Dictionary definition and meaning for word denizen

    (noun) a person who inhabits a particular place Definition
    (noun) a plant or animal naturalized in a region
    Example Sentence
    • denizens of field and forest
    • denizens of the deep
   Mnemonics (Memory Aids) for denizen

this word rhymes with the word citizen (which can be related to the above meaning)

den is lion's resting place. the lion uses its car(zen) to reach its home everyday.

resiDENt + citIZEN = DENIZEN

Powered by Mnemonic Dictionary

lion has made zen car as den ..so it is inhabitant and occupant of zen..

Download our Mobile App Today
Receive our word of the day
on Whatsapp